+923345918782
info@rankupmarksolutions.com

AI Prompt Engineering: The Key to Unlocking Smarter AI Responses

Artificial Intelligence (AI) has become an integral part of various industries, revolutionizing the way we interact with technology. One critical aspect that determines the effectiveness of AI systems is prompt engineering. This process involves crafting precise inputs to guide AI models toward generating accurate and relevant responses. In this comprehensive guide, we delve into the nuances of AI prompt engineering, exploring techniques, recent advancements, and best practices to unlock smarter AI responses.

Understanding AI Prompt Engineering:

Prompt engineering refers to the art and science of designing inputs (prompts) that elicit desired outputs from AI models. The quality and structure of a prompt significantly influence the AI’s performance, making it essential to understand how to formulate effective prompts.

The Importance of Effective Prompting

Effective prompts serve as the foundation for obtaining accurate and relevant AI-generated content. They help in:

  • Enhancing AI Accuracy: Well-crafted prompts reduce ambiguity, enabling AI models to provide precise answers.
  • Improving Efficiency: Clear instructions minimize the need for follow-up queries, saving time and resources.
  • Ensuring Relevance: Specific prompts guide AI to generate content that aligns closely with user intent.

Techniques for Effective AI Prompt Engineering:

Several techniques have emerged to enhance the effectiveness of prompts:

  1. Chain-of-Thought (CoT) Prompting

Chain-of-Thought prompting encourages AI models to process information in a step-by-step manner, mimicking human reasoning. This approach is particularly beneficial for complex problem-solving tasks. For instance, when asked a multi-step math problem, an AI using CoT prompting will outline each calculation stage, leading to more accurate results.

Example:

Q: The cafeteria had 23 apples. If they used 20 to make lunch and bought 6 more, how many apples do they have?

A: The cafeteria had 23 apples originally. They used 20 to make lunch. So they had 23 – 20 = 3. They bought 6 more apples, so they have 3 + 6 = 9. The answer is 9.

This method has been shown to significantly improve reasoning abilities in large language models (LLMs)

  1. In-Context Learning

In-Context Learning involves providing AI models with examples within the prompt to guide their responses. This technique allows models to learn patterns and apply them to new, similar tasks without explicit training.

Example:

Translate the following English words to French:

  1. cat – chat
  2. dog – chien
  3. bird –

In this case, the AI is expected to continue the pattern and provide the French translation for “bird.”

  1. ReAct (Reasoning and Acting) Pattern

The ReAct pattern integrates reasoning and acting by prompting AI to generate reasoning traces and task-specific actions in an interleaved manner. This approach enhances the model’s ability to handle complex tasks by allowing it to plan, monitor, and update its actions based on intermediate reasoning.

Example:

Q: What is the elevation range for the area that the eastern sector of the Colorado orogeny extends into?

Thought 1: I need to search for information about the Colorado orogeny and its eastern sector.

Action 1: Search[Colorado orogeny]

Observation 1: The Colorado orogeny was an episode of mountain building in Colorado and surrounding areas.

Thought 2: I need more specific information about the eastern sector.

Action 2: Lookup[eastern sector]

Observation 2: The eastern sector extends into the High Plains and is called the Central Plains orogeny.

Thought 3: Now I need to find the elevation range of the High Plains.

Action 3: Search[High Plains elevation range]

Observation 3: The High Plains rise in elevation from around 1,800 to 7,000 ft (550 to 2,130 m).

Thought 4: I have found the answer.

Action 4: Finish[1,800 to 7,000 ft]

This pattern synergizes reasoning and acting, leading to more accurate and context-aware responses

Recent Advancements in Prompt Engineering

The field of prompt engineering is continually evolving, with recent studies highlighting its effectiveness:

  • Enhanced Problem-Solving: OpenAI’s latest model, nicknamed “Strawberry,” incorporates a “think, then answer” approach, significantly improving its problem-solving capabilities in scientific fields and mathematics
  • Expert Utilization: AI executives from top consulting firms emphasize the importance of context in prompts and iterative questioning to achieve optimal results. They advocate for hands-on experimentation and refinement of prompt quality to harness AI’s full potential

Best Practices for Crafting Effective Prompts

To maximize the potential of AI models, consider the following best practices when crafting prompts:

  1. Be Clear and Specific

Ambiguity can lead to irrelevant or incorrect responses. Ensure that prompts are precise and convey the exact information or action required.

Example:

Instead of: “Tell me about Python.”

Use: “Provide an overview of Python programming language, including its key features and applications.”

  1. Provide Context

Offering background information helps AI models understand the scope and nuances of the request, leading to more accurate responses.

Example:

As a software developer, explain the benefits of using version control systems like Git.

  1. Define the Desired Format

Specifying the format guides the AI in structuring its response appropriately.

Example:

List the top 5 benefits of regular exercise.

  1. Use Step-by-Step Instructions

Breaking down complex tasks into smaller steps can improve the coherence and accuracy of AI responses.

Example:

Explain how to set up a new email account, including steps for choosing a provider, creating an account, and configuring settings.

  1. Incorporate Examples

Providing examples within the prompt can illustrate the expected response style or content, aiding the AI in generating relevant outputs.

Example:

Translate the following English words to Spanish:

  1. Apple –
  2. Book –
  3. House –

Challenges and Considerations in Prompt Engineering

While prompt engineering offers numerous benefits, it also presents challenges:

  • Sensitivity to Prompt Variations: AI models can exhibit varying performance based on subtle changes in prompt wording or structure. Research indicates that linguistic features significantly influence prompt effectiveness
  • Risk of Misuse: Poorly designed prompts can lead AI models to produce harmful or unethical outputs. For instance, researchers have demonstrated that AI-powered robots can be manipulated into performing dangerous actions, highlighting the need for robust safety measures.

 

Leave a Comment